1,3-Diphenyl-2-propenone was used in the preparation of pharmacologically-interesting heterocyclic systems like pyrazolines and pyrimidines。

| Description | This compound belongs to the class of organic compounds known as retrochalcones. These are a form of normal chalcones that are structurally distinguished by the lack of oxygen functionalities at the C2'- and C6'-positions. |
